Welcome! This site contains links to material relevant to my professional life. I'm an IT professional with experience in a range of disciplines and technologies but probably best known for my involvement in databases such as CockroachDB, MongoDB, Oracle and MySql and for my work on emerging database and Blockchain technologies.

I’m currently employed at OneSpan, who recently acquired the ProvenDB - a blockchain-enabled database service - technology that I founded at Southbank Software.

I'm the author of CockroachDB Definitive Guide, MongoDB Performance Tuning, Architecting Distributed Transactional Applications, Next Generation Databases,  Oracle Performance Survival Guide, MySql Stored Procedure Programming (with Steven Feuerstein), Oracle SQL High Performance Tuning, as well as contributing to several other books on database technology. I write monthly columns at Database Trends and Applications and more occasional articles elsewhere.
